3. Key Drivers & Constraints

  1. Demand Driver (Consumer Trends): Strong demand is linked to seasonal holidays (Easter, Mother's Day) and the "biophilic design" trend, incorporating natural elements into home and office spaces. Vibrant colors like hot pink are particularly popular on social media platforms, driving impulse purchases.
  2. Cost Driver (Energy): Greenhouse heating is a primary cost input. Natural gas prices in Europe, a key production region, remain volatile and significantly impact grower margins and final unit price.
  3. Supply Constraint (Climate): Bulb quality and yield are highly dependent on specific climatic conditions during the growth and dormancy phases. Unseasonal weather patterns in key growing regions like the Netherlands can reduce bulb availability and quality.
  4. Logistics Constraint (Perishability): The product has a short shelf-life, requiring an expensive and precise cold chain (2-5°C). Any disruption in air or refrigerated truck freight poses a significant risk of product loss.
  5. Regulatory Driver (Phytosanitary): Strict cross-border plant health regulations (e.g., USDA APHIS) require pest-free certification and can cause shipment delays or rejections, adding cost and risk.

5. Pricing Mechanics

The price build-up for a finished, potted hot pink hyacinth is a multi-stage process. It begins with the cost of the bulb from a Dutch breeder/exporter, which is set 12-18 months in advance. The next major cost is forcing, where a grower cultivates the bulb in a climate-controlled greenhouse for 10-13 weeks; this stage includes costs for soil, pot, labor, and, most critically, energy for heating. Finally, logistics and packaging add a significant premium, covering refrigerated transport from the grower to the distribution center and onto the final point of sale.

The three most volatile cost elements are: 1. Natural Gas (for heating): Subject to extreme geopolitical and market pressures. Recent change: Fluctuation of +/- 40% over the last 18 months [Source - European Energy Exchange, 2023-2024]. 2. Air & Refrigerated Freight: Impacted by fuel surcharges, labor availability, and seasonal capacity demand. Recent change: est. +15% YoY. 3. Labor: Rising wage floors and competition for skilled horticultural labor in both the EU and North America. Recent change: est. +5-8% YoY.

8. Regional Focus: North Carolina (USA)

North Carolina possesses a robust horticultural industry, ranking among the top states for greenhouse and nursery products. Demand for live hyacinths is strong, driven by proximity to major East Coast metropolitan areas and a vibrant local gifting market. While the state's climate is not ideal for commercial bulb production (which remains centered in the Pacific Northwest and the Netherlands), it has significant capacity for "forcing" imported bulbs in its extensive network of modern greenhouses. Favorable corporate tax rates and access to skilled agricultural labor from universities like NC State are advantages. However, procurement will be exposed to rising local labor costs and inbound freight costs for bulbs.
